Output ebb69c63aac39a27b86433f539f5bf3d842b8af5d0c1502f0ff14244d067a03f:1

value
1018573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cb4dfc157299488ac9dd026aa0016da860f156e OP_EQUAL
address
3Mp1G6UxtACdvM48FFbKkk6RkPwxMygfZk
transaction
ebb69c63aac39a27b86433f539f5bf3d842b8af5d0c1502f0ff14244d067a03f
spent
true